Why are EV battery prices coming down faster than expected? There are two main drivers. One is technological innovation. We''re seeing multiple new battery products that have been launched that feature about 30% higher energy density and lower cost. The second driver is a continued downturn in battery metal prices.

Since early 2000s, the proportion of knowledge contributed by new applicants has increased steadily. These new applicants come not only from the US and Japan, but also from China, particularly since 2006 (Malhotra et al., 2021). In terms of production, Japan used to lead the world in mass production of LIBs, but was later overtaken by South Korea.

The sensitivity of battery pack prices to commodity prices is much lower than commonly understood. A 50% increase in lithium prices would for instance increase the battery pack price of a nickel-manganese-cobalt (NMC) 811 battery by less than 4%. Similarly, a doubling of cobalt prices would result in a 3% increase in the overall pack price.

The trend has ground to a halt this year, with BloombergNEF''s annual lithium-ion battery price survey showing a 7% increase in average pack prices in 2022 in real terms. This is the first increase in the history of the survey.
